сокращение пространства между ячейками в UITableView - почему этот код не делает этого? - PullRequest
0 голосов
/ 07 сентября 2011

любые идеи, почему я не могу уменьшить / удалить пространство между ячейками в Grouped UITableView (одна ячейка на раздел). Я включаю в контроллер следующее:

- (CGFloat) tableView:(UITableView *)tableView heightForHeaderInSection:(NSInteger)section {
    return 0.0;
}

- (CGFloat) tableView:(UITableView *)tableView heightForFooterInSection:(NSInteger)section {
    return 0.0;
}

Я все еще получаю пробелы между ячейками даже с этим кодом. Поместите границу вокруг клеток, и пространство не от самих клеток.

1 Ответ

0 голосов
/ 07 сентября 2011

Согласно предложению PengOne взглянуть на ответ здесь , у меня не было места, которое заставило его работать, следующее:

-(UIView*)tableView:(UITableView*)tableView viewForHeaderInSection:(NSInteger)section
{
    return [[[UIView alloc] initWithFrame:CGRectMake(0, 0, 0, 0)] autorelease];
}

-(UIView*)tableView:(UITableView*)tableView viewForFooterInSection:(NSInteger)section
{
    return [[[UIView alloc] initWithFrame:CGRectMake(0, 0, 0, 0)] autorelease];
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...